Yes, please fix missing students for Colleges and University - Students drive parents car won't get home for days and somewhat missing from the grid, resulting "No longer educated". Using school bus to collect students from Arcology seems a quick fix, but 10% of educated sent back to Arcology leaving the uneducated staying in the residential. But its ok, I didn't hurt the industry that much. Just a little nuisance.

 

We would love to see students commute from other cities or from Arcology to Colleges and University. For now all I can see students commute between cities is only applied to Grade/High Schools (with School Buses)

Smoother and better capability in working with other players. 

 

  • So far as I know no one from EA has come forward and properly explained the green and red and gray borders around other players in your reigion.  You can figure them out a little, but... they do sometimes seem to change haphazardly.
  • The ability to wheel and deal for resources would be nice "I need processors, how much you want to sell them to me for?"  OR set up producers the same way we buy electricty, water and power: "X city builds processors, start importing them for X simoleons?"
  • Drop the ridiculous automatic "X mayor comes to your town on a visit" - that notification should only come up when a fellow human mayor chooses to look at your city.
  • Few people choose a city specialization - you can't even pick Omega specialization.  Drop it.
  • A few VERY multiplayer-friendly regions.  We need a five-city all-connected by everything (road rail and water) region where every city plot has Ore/Coal/Oil, a good water table everywhere and all the plots are flat.  Why?  Because when trying to find a region where there are active players too often all the best spots are taken up.  If you're in the mood to make a mining city and the mining spots are all taken up you're screwed.  Or the onle plot left is the hilly one it's hard to work with.
  • The ability to create a reigion where a player can have only one city.  What's the point of multiplayer when someone if juggling cities among themselves?
  • The ability to sort regions by active players and non-sandbox.
  • A timer on newly created cities.  If a player joins a region, lays one road and then leaves, that plot is dead to other players.  There ought to be a way to revert towns that have less than 5,000 population to "open to new players" status.

Fix how each building produce garbage cans per day. Example, Low Wealth Residential + High Density produce 100 cans of garbage on the start of the day (which is ok, fair enough). Once it collected, the very same residential produce another 100 cans of garbage for another 3 to 4 in game hours, thus having 500-600 cans of garbage for each lot per day (is that even logical?). Having large populace city will hurt Garbage Dumps and left "Garbage cans collected" in red. This applied to all buildings. Educated buildings doesn't help either.
